What does a Client Manager do?

A Client Manager is responsible for maintaining and growing relationships with an organization’s clients. They serve as the main point of contact, ensuring clients' needs are met and addressing any issues or concerns. Their duties often include managing client accounts, communicating regularly with clients, coordinating with internal teams to deliver products or services, and identifying opportunities for upselling or cross-selling. The goal of a Client Manager is to foster client satisfaction and loyalty, ultimately contributing to the company’s growth.

What is the difference between Client Manager vs Account Executive?

AspectClient ManagerAccount Executive
Primary RoleMaintains client relationships, ensures client satisfaction, manages ongoing accountsGenerates new business, acquires new clients, presents products/services
Required SkillsCustomer service, communication, relationship managementSales, negotiation, presentation skills
Work EnvironmentLong-term client engagement, account management teamsSales pitches, client meetings, prospecting
Industry UsageCommon in consulting, marketing, techCommon in sales, advertising, tech

While both roles involve client interaction, a Client Manager focuses on maintaining and growing existing client relationships, ensuring satisfaction and retention. An Account Executive primarily works on acquiring new clients and closing sales. Understanding these differences helps in choosing the right career path or job search focus.

What are some common challenges Client Managers face when handling multiple client accounts simultaneously?

Client Managers often juggle several client accounts at once, which can present challenges such as managing competing priorities, ensuring consistent communication, and meeting diverse expectations. Time management and organization skills are crucial, as is the ability to quickly adapt to different client needs and industry sectors. Building strong relationships with both clients and internal teams helps mitigate misunderstandings and ensures deadlines and deliverables are met. Regular check-ins, clear documentation, and proactive problem-solving are key strategies to successfully navigate these challenges.

Here's Where You Come In

The BenefitsAssociateAccount Managerprovides administrative and clerical support to the Employee Benefits Channelin accordance withcompany practices,policiesand procedures.Thisincludes assisting account managers with client needs, assisting with compliance, and completing paperwork in a timely manner.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Assist account team in providing quality customer service to existing accounts; this includes, but is not limited to: Assistance in resolving billing and claim issues, gathering renewal information and general account assistance asneeded

  • Assisting account team with annual enrollment by helping create communicationmaterial

  • Assist with special projects in the office asrequested

  • Monitor and maintain accurate client information in account management systems asassigned

  • Act in capacity of client manager on assignedaccounts
